Sean O’Malley vs. Cory Sandhagen could be a possibility in 2026.
The UFC stars have yet to cross paths in the bantamweight division, but O’Malley and Sandhagen do share common opponents in the champion Merab Dvalishvili, Aljamain Sterling, Petr Yan, and Chito Vera.
Prior to Sandhagen’s title fight loss against Dvalishvili at UFC 320, O’Malley mentioned ‘Sandman’ as a potential fight for him at the UFC’s White House event in June.
Sandhagen has long wanted to fight O’Malley, a fellow striker at 135 lbs.
O’Malley’s head coach doesn’t think Sandhagen will want to stand and trade with the former champion after his latest performance.
Sandhagen had his moments against Dvalishvili, fighting a pretty decent first round against the champion.
However, Dvalishvili nearly knocked out Sandhagen with strikes in the second round, leaving coach Tim Welch to believe he won’t be taking those chances in a potential fight against O’Malley.
“Cory is not an easy guy because he’s so good at mixing it in,” Welch said of Sandhagen as an opponent for O’Malley on his YouTube channel.
“But I do think you saw how hurt he was vs. Merab hitting him. And Merab is confident. He’s throwing those punches hard. But again, Suga f—— hits people hard, dude.

“And he hits them on the money, lights out, hurts them to their body real hard, and then he finds a spot to put it on the money. Boom. To just KO somebody.
“So, I think it’ll be the first guy Cory’s fought who hits as hard as Suga.
“Cory, he’s gonna be trying to shoot…
“He’s not gonna just sit there and strike with Sean. He says he is, but he’s not. He’s gonna mix in shots, try to get on top, try to do what he did vs. Chito Vera,” Welch said of Sandhagen’s strategy for O’Malley.
Sign Sandhagen up for a fight with O’Malley on the White House lawn.
Speaking on the Ariel Helwani Show following his loss to Dvalishvili, Sandhagen says he wants a piece of ‘Suga’ next summer.
“Me and O’Malley has to happen,” Sandhagen said.
“That White House card would be sick to fight on against O’Malley.
“That would be such a gigantic fight,” the top contender added.
